Sailor Piece Clans Guide

In Sailor Piece, Clans are one of the most important systems for increasing your overall power. They provide passive stat bonuses that directly impact your performance in farming, boss fights, and PvP.

These bonuses can include:

  • Damage increase
  • Max HP boost
  • Damage reduction
  • Sword or Melee scaling
  • Luck and drop rate bonuses
  • EXP, money, and gem boosts

Unlike gear or abilities, Clan buffs are always active. This makes them one of the highest value progression systems in the game.


What Are Clans?

Clans function as a permanent passive modifier tied to your character. Once assigned, they continuously enhance your stats without requiring activation.

They work alongside:

  • Races
  • Traits
  • Accessories

This means your Clan choice should always align with your overall build strategy (fruit, sword, or melee).


Clan Rarity & Tier System

Clans are divided into rarity tiers. Higher rarity generally means stronger stats and additional effects.


Legendary Clans (Best in Game)

These provide the highest stat scaling and often include unique effects.

ClanBuffs & EffectsNotes
Espada+32% Damage, +505 HP, +10% Sword DMG, +10% Luck, bonus damage after ability usageStrong burst potential
Pride+30% Damage, +45% HP, +10% Sword DMG, +10% Luck, stacking damage bonusBest all-around Clan
Monarch+27% Damage, +40% HP, +7% Sword DMG, +10% Luck, +20% drop chanceBest for farming
Voldigoat+25% Damage, +35% HP, +7% Melee DMG, +10% Damage Reduction, bonus vs low HP targetsBest melee scaling

Legendary Clans are the optimal endgame goal due to their strong scaling and additional effects.


Epic Clans (Strong Mid-Tier)

These offer balanced stats and are solid for progression.

ClanBuffs
Mugetsu+20% Damage, +25% HP, +5% Damage Reduction, +2% Lifesteal
Yamato+17% Damage, +27% HP, +5% Melee DMG, +20% Gems Gain

Epic Clans are ideal if you haven’t rolled a Legendary yet.


Rare Clans

Decent performance with useful utility bonuses.

ClanBuffs
Zoldyck+15% Damage, +20% HP, +20% Sprint Speed, +15% Gems Gain

Good for mobility and farming efficiency.


Uncommon & Common Clans

Lower-tier options mainly used in early game.

ClanBuffs
Raikage (Uncommon)+10% Damage, +15% HP, +10% Jump, +10% Money & Gems
Sasaki (Common)+7% Damage, +10% HP, +10% EXP

These help early progression but should be replaced as soon as possible.


Best Clans to Aim For

If you're optimizing for performance, prioritize:

  • Pride — Best overall scaling and versatility
  • Monarch — Best for farming and drop efficiency
  • Voldigoat — Strongest melee-focused option
  • Espada — High burst potential for PvP

If Legendary rolls are not available, Epic clans like Mugetsu and Yamato are strong alternatives.


How to Get Clan Rerolls

Clan Rerolls allow you to change your Clan. They are limited resources, so use them strategically.

Main Sources

  • Enemy drops — All NPCs have a chance to drop rerolls
  • Chests — Found across islands with random rewards
  • Dungeons — Reward completion with reroll items
  • Events / Shops — Some game modes or vendors offer rerolls

Reroll rates for Legendary Clans are low, so expect multiple attempts.


Reroll Strategy Tips

  • Do not settle early — Replace Common/Uncommon as soon as possible
  • Save rerolls for mid-game+ — Higher value when chasing Legendary
  • Match your build
    • Melee → Voldigoat
    • Sword → Pride / Espada
    • Farming → Monarch
  • Stack systems together — Combine Clan + Race + Trait + Accessories for maximum scaling

Frequently Asked Questions

Are Clans important?
Yes. Even a low-tier Clan provides meaningful stat boosts and improves progression speed.

Can you reroll infinitely?
Yes, as long as you have Clan Reroll items.

Should you reroll early?
Light rerolling early is fine, but heavy rerolling is more efficient in mid-to-late game.

Do Clans affect PvP?
Absolutely. High-tier Clans significantly impact damage, survivability, and overall combat performance.
